Claude 3.7 Sonnet is a multimodal language model developed by Anthropic. It achieves strong performance with an average score of 74.1% across 11 benchmarks. It excels particularly in MATH-500 (96.2%), IFEval (93.2%), MMMLU (86.1%). It supports a 328K token context window for handling large documents. The model is available through 4 API providers. As a multimodal model, it can process and understand text, images, and other input formats seamlessly. Released in 2025, it represents Anthropic's latest advancement in AI technology.

GPT OSS 20B is a language model developed by OpenAI. The model shows competitive results across 7 benchmarks. It excels particularly in MMLU (85.3%), CodeForces (83.9%), GPQA (71.5%). It supports a 262K token context window for handling large documents. The model is available through 4 API providers. It's licensed for commercial use, making it suitable for enterprise applications. Released in 2025, it represents OpenAI's latest advancement in AI technology.
